Planning a pet is an important decision and one should not take it lightly. For a home that has young kids, it becomes ever more essential to choose the right kind of pet. Dogs such as Labrador, Spaniel, Rottweiler, German Shepherd, Golden Retriever, Boxer, Beagle, Poodle, Pug, Pomerians, Lhasa Apsos and Dachshund have been popular among pet lover. However, the idea of taking these dogs, as pets should be a well-planned decision rather than a hurried conclusion.
If you want a dog for home security, you will choose Labrador, Rottweiler and German Shepherd rather than Poodle or a Dachshund. Dog training is an essential way to ensure obedience from your pet. A spoilt and unruly pet can lead you in trouble. While choosing a pet, try to know more about its breed, its temperament and health. If you choose a dog that is known for its lack of patience, you have to be more careful while imparting training. Training imparted to pet should be in accordance to its breed and its skills. Always remember that pets are like young children. Getting harsh and strict would not solve the purpose until you train the dog with patience.
While selecting dog food, dog food differs from puppy, adult dog and senior dog. One should choose the right formula of dog food customized as per the requirements of dog. Pets should be gives nutritious diet that includes chicken, vegetables, brown rice and milk. Food rich in Vitamin A, E and C is the best health diet. Stay away from packed and canned food, as it is high in preservatives. Ask your veterinary and get a diet chart for your pet.
